Romney Selects Ryan as VP Candidate Ironically in Norfolk

Navid Roshan-Afshar
@thetysonscorner
August 11, 2012
Did you know that our naval warships are created out of thin air when corporations wish upon a star? And then they donate them to the Navy for free! Thanks Corporations!

The GOP is always good for a laugh. As if the party didn’t have enough bad history with using Naval ships as election cycle props they have selected which GOP example of prosperity and growth for their announcement? Norfolk Virginia! A city which voted 91% in support of Obama in 2008 and vehemently opposes the over reaching control of Bob McDonnell who consistently dictates state requirements on the incorporated and independent city against its will.

Romney’s first words about Norfolk were about how beautiful and important of a city it is. Absolutely I couldn’t agree more. The city, due to urbanization projects centered around mass transit (something that the GOP has literally gutted in every bill they have gotten their hands on) have turned the industrially focused city into a safe and habitable zone for its residents.

I wonder if anyone let the GOP know, in between their ironic shouts of “you did build that” that the very naval warship they stood in front of was built on government money. I wonder if anyone let the GOP know that the two locations in Virginia that they denoted in their speeches as examples of american prosperity (Norfolk and Fairfax) were built off of receiving contracts from the government?

McDonnell’s rhetoric was laughable, announcing that it was Obama who is stopping oil drilling off the coast of Norfolk (I’m sure those oil platforms, necessary refineries, and the impending oil spills would help that new beautiful and pristine Norfolk seafront). In fact off shore oil drilling, mining of uranium in the Blue Ridge, and other heavy industrial operations have been emphatically opposed by both parties in Virginia. Democrats view it as an environmental disaster in the works and Republicans view it as corporate destruction of rural lands.
